What is Mountain Top Library?
Mountain Top Library is a public institution dedicated to fostering community engagement and lifelong learning. It offers a diverse array of programs and services, including art clubs for children, financial literacy workshops for teenagers, and crucial health insurance navigation assistance. The library also serves as a cultural hub, hosting events such as poetry readings and movie screenings, thereby catering to a broad spectrum of community interests and needs. Its client base encompasses children, teens, and local residents seeking educational enrichment and cultural experiences.
